AppointmentStore.ShowReplaceAppointmentAsync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Перегрузки
ShowReplaceAppointmentAsync(String, Appointment, Rect) |
Показывает пользовательский интерфейс поставщика встреч для замены встреч, чтобы пользователь мог заменить встречу. |
ShowReplaceAppointmentAsync(String, Appointment, Rect, Placement, DateTime) |
Показывает пользовательский интерфейс поставщика встреч для замены встреч, чтобы пользователь мог заменить встречу. |
ShowReplaceAppointmentAsync(String, Appointment, Rect)
Показывает пользовательский интерфейс поставщика встреч для замены встреч, чтобы пользователь мог заменить встречу.
public:
virtual IAsyncOperation<Platform::String ^> ^ ShowReplaceAppointmentAsync(Platform::String ^ localId, Appointment ^ appointment, Rect selection) = ShowReplaceAppointmentAsync;
/// [Windows.Foundation.Metadata.Overload("ShowReplaceAppointmentAsync")]
/// [Windows.Foundation.Metadata.RemoteAsync]
IAsyncOperation<winrt::hstring> ShowReplaceAppointmentAsync(winrt::hstring const& localId, Appointment const& appointment, Rect const& selection);
/// [Windows.Foundation.Metadata.Overload("ShowReplaceAppointmentAsync")]
IAsyncOperation<winrt::hstring> ShowReplaceAppointmentAsync(winrt::hstring const& localId, Appointment const& appointment, Rect const& selection);
[Windows.Foundation.Metadata.Overload("ShowReplaceAppointmentAsync")]
[Windows.Foundation.Metadata.RemoteAsync]
public IAsyncOperation<string> ShowReplaceAppointmentAsync(string localId, Appointment appointment, Rect selection);
[Windows.Foundation.Metadata.Overload("ShowReplaceAppointmentAsync")]
public IAsyncOperation<string> ShowReplaceAppointmentAsync(string localId, Appointment appointment, Rect selection);
function showReplaceAppointmentAsync(localId, appointment, selection)
Public Function ShowReplaceAppointmentAsync (localId As String, appointment As Appointment, selection As Rect) As IAsyncOperation(Of String)
Параметры
- appointment
- Appointment
Объект , представляющий встречу для замены существующей встречи.
- selection
- Rect
Прямоугольник — это прямоугольная область выбора пользователем (например, нажатие кнопки), вокруг которой операционная система отображает пользовательский интерфейс замены встречи, а не в этой прямоугольной области. Например, если приложение использует кнопку для отображения rect, передайте прямоугольник кнопки, чтобы пользовательский интерфейс замены встречи отображал вокруг кнопки, не перекрывая ее.
Возвращаемое значение
После завершения этого метода он возвращает объект String , представляющий RoamingId встречи, заменив существующую встречу.
- Атрибуты
Требования к Windows
Возможности приложения |
appointmentsSystem
|
См. также раздел
Применяется к
ShowReplaceAppointmentAsync(String, Appointment, Rect, Placement, DateTime)
Показывает пользовательский интерфейс поставщика встреч для замены встреч, чтобы пользователь мог заменить встречу.
public:
virtual IAsyncOperation<Platform::String ^> ^ ShowReplaceAppointmentAsync(Platform::String ^ localId, Appointment ^ appointment, Rect selection, Placement preferredPlacement, DateTime instanceStartDate) = ShowReplaceAppointmentAsync;
/// [Windows.Foundation.Metadata.Overload("ShowReplaceAppointmentWithPlacementAndDateAsync")]
/// [Windows.Foundation.Metadata.RemoteAsync]
IAsyncOperation<winrt::hstring> ShowReplaceAppointmentAsync(winrt::hstring const& localId, Appointment const& appointment, Rect const& selection, Placement const& preferredPlacement, DateTime const& instanceStartDate);
/// [Windows.Foundation.Metadata.Overload("ShowReplaceAppointmentWithPlacementAndDateAsync")]
IAsyncOperation<winrt::hstring> ShowReplaceAppointmentAsync(winrt::hstring const& localId, Appointment const& appointment, Rect const& selection, Placement const& preferredPlacement, DateTime const& instanceStartDate);
[Windows.Foundation.Metadata.Overload("ShowReplaceAppointmentWithPlacementAndDateAsync")]
[Windows.Foundation.Metadata.RemoteAsync]
public IAsyncOperation<string> ShowReplaceAppointmentAsync(string localId, Appointment appointment, Rect selection, Placement preferredPlacement, System.DateTimeOffset instanceStartDate);
[Windows.Foundation.Metadata.Overload("ShowReplaceAppointmentWithPlacementAndDateAsync")]
public IAsyncOperation<string> ShowReplaceAppointmentAsync(string localId, Appointment appointment, Rect selection, Placement preferredPlacement, System.DateTimeOffset instanceStartDate);
function showReplaceAppointmentAsync(localId, appointment, selection, preferredPlacement, instanceStartDate)
Public Function ShowReplaceAppointmentAsync (localId As String, appointment As Appointment, selection As Rect, preferredPlacement As Placement, instanceStartDate As DateTimeOffset) As IAsyncOperation(Of String)
Параметры
- appointment
- Appointment
Объект , представляющий встречу для замены существующей встречи.
- selection
- Rect
Прямоугольник — это прямоугольная область выбора пользователем (например, нажатие кнопки), вокруг которой операционная система отображает пользовательский интерфейс замены встречи, а не в этой прямоугольной области. Например, если приложение использует кнопку для отображения rect, передайте прямоугольник кнопки, чтобы пользовательский интерфейс замены встречи отображал вокруг кнопки, не перекрывая ее.
- preferredPlacement
- Placement
Расположение, описывающее предпочтительное размещение пользовательского интерфейса замены встречи.
- instanceStartDate
- DateTime DateTimeOffset
Дата и время начала заменяемого экземпляра встречи.
Возвращаемое значение
После завершения этого метода он возвращает объект String , представляющий RoamingId встречи, заменив существующую встречу.
- Атрибуты
Требования к Windows
Возможности приложения |
appointmentsSystem
|
Комментарии
Параметр instanceStartTime должен быть исходной датой начала экземпляра.